What is cache and why should it be cleaned on Redmi 7A
Cache is a buffer memory that stores temporary data. When you launch an application or visit a website, the system stores some information so that the next time you access it, you can download content instantly. For a budget device like the Redmi 7A with its limited internal memory, managing that data correctly is critical.
The problem is when old files are not deleted automatically, and new ones are written, which leads to fragmentation of data and logical errors in the operation of programs. If you notice that the MIUI interface has slowed down or applications are taken out immediately after opening, most likely the reason lies in the crowded cache.
โ ๏ธ Caution: Clearing the cache does not delete your personal photos, contacts or correspondence. However, deleting the data of a particular application (not to be confused with cache) can reset its settings to factory.
Regular storage maintenance allows you to free up gigabytes of space. On the 7A model, where the base version often has only 32 GB of memory, releasing even 1-2 GB can be a crucial factor for installing an important update or a new game. Optimizing the system through removing junk files is the first step in diagnosing any software problems.
Use of the built-in "Security" application
The easiest and safest way to remove cache on the Xiaomi Redmi 7A is to use the standard shell toolkit. The company has built a powerful combine to maintain the system directly into the settings menu, which is ideal for regular preventive maintenance and does not require special knowledge.
To start the procedure, look for an app called Security on your desktop or in the Tools folder, which is usually a green shield icon, run the program and wait for the automatic check to be completed, and the system will analyze the amount of garbage it occupies and suggest solutions.
In the window that opens, select Clean. The app will show you a list of files that can be deleted without harming the system. This includes remnants of deleted applications, temporary browser files and the system cache. Press Clean to start the deletion process.
- ๐ฑ Click on the Security app iconยป.
- ๐งน Select the โCleaningโ tab in the bottom or top menu.
- โ Wait for the scan and press the delete button.
- ๐ Repeat the procedure once in a while. 1-2 weeks to maintain speed.
Itโs worth noting that the built-in scanner is sometimes too conservative to delete all possible temporary files to keep some services running, but for most users, this level of cleanup is enough to make the Redmi 7A comfortable.
Manually cleaning the cache of individual applications
Sometimes the problem isnโt with the system as a whole, but with a specific โheavyโ application, like Telegram, YouTube, or Chrome, which can accumulate gigabytes of data, requiring a spot manual cleaning through Android settings.
Go to the Settings menu of your smartphone. Find the Apps section and select All Apps. You will see the full list of installed software. Find the program that consumes the most resources in the list and click on it.
โ๏ธ Check before cleaning the application
Inside the app menu, look for the Memory or Storage button, and here you will see two options: Clear Cache and Clear Everything (or Erase Data). To delete only temporary files, select the first option. This action is secure and will not affect your logins or settings inside the program.
| Annex | Type of data | Recommended action | Risk of data loss |
|---|---|---|---|
| Chrome/Browser | Images, scripts | Clear the cache | Low (to be logged out of accounts) |
| Telegram | Photos, videos, files | Clean through the settings inside the application | Low (will remain in the cloud) |
| YouTube | Preview, video buffer | Clear the cache | Absent. |
| gallery | Miniatures. | Clear the cache | Absent. |
If the app doesn't work properly even after the cache has been cleared, you can try pressing Clear Everything, which will return the program to state immediately after installation, and be careful: all settings within the app will be reset and you will need to reauthorize.
Deep cleaning through the Recovery menu
If the Redmi 7A is extremely slow or freezes during the boot phase, it may be necessary to clear the cache through Recovery Mode, which removes system temporary files that cannot be accessed through the normal interface, a deeper cleanup that affects the operating system itself.
To enter this mode, you need to turn the device off completely. Then simultaneously press the volume button and the power button. Hold them until the Mi logo appears, then release the power button, but keep the volume. In a few seconds, you will see a menu with several items in English.
โ ๏ธ Attention: Navigation in the Recovery menu is done with volume buttons (up/down), and the choice of item is confirmed by the power button.
Use the volume buttons to select the Wipe Cache Partition. Confirm the power button. The system will warn you of the consequences, you will need to choose Yes or Confirm. The process will take a few seconds, after which the success message will appear. Select Reboot system now to restart.

Clearing the cache through a computer (ADB command)
For advanced users who want to gain full control of Redmi 7A, There is a method of cleaning through debugging USB. Use of the ADB (Android Debug Bridge allows you to delete cache even those applications that are normally protected from user interference. USB.
First, you need to activate the developer mode on your phone. โ About the phone and seven times quickly click on the build number (MIUI After the message โYou became a developerโ appears, go back to the main settings menu, find the section Additional โ For developers and include the Debugging item USB.
adb shell pm trim-caches 999999999Connect your smartphone to your PC, install ADB drivers, and type the command in the command line. The command above forcibly trims the cache of all applications to a minimum, a powerful tool that can instantly free up a significant amount of memory.
- ๐ป Connect your phone to your computer in file transfer mode.
- ๐ง Allow debugging in the pop-up window on the smartphone screen.
- โจ๏ธ Enter the command. ADB cleaning cache in the PC terminal.
- ๐ Check the vacated space in the storage settings.
Using this method requires caution. Incorrectly typing commands can lead to unstable system operation, but when used correctly, it is the most effective way to deep clean without losing personal data.
Automation and useful optimization tips
To avoid manual cleaning, you can set up process automation. The Security app has a speed-up feature that you can set up to automatically start when you don't have enough memory. There are also third-party apps, but they are often less efficient than built-in tools on Xiaomi because of aggressive energy-saving policies.
๐ก
Turn off auto-update apps in the Play Market for heavy gaming and social media if you donโt use them daily, and this will prevent the update cache from accumulating in the background.
You should also pay attention to the memory extension feature, if available in your version of MIUI. It allows you to use part of the internal storage as RAM, which indirectly affects the cache, making the system more responsive. However, on the Redmi 7A with its modest characteristics, it is better not to overload the system with unnecessary widgets and live wallpaper.
โ ๏ธ Warning: Don't install questionable Play Market "cleaners" that often contain ads and consume resources themselves, slowing down your Redmi. 7A speed up.
Regularly restarting the device is another simple but effective method: When you turn off and on the phone, the system automatically resets some of the time processes and clears the RAM, which has a positive effect on overall performance.
